A BILL
To amend the Outer Continental Shelf Lands Act to provide deadlines for
the development of five-year oil and gas leasing programs, and for
other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Strategy to Secure Offshore Energy
Act''.
SEC. 2. PUBLISHING A FIVE-YEAR PLAN FOR OFFSHORE OIL AND GAS LEASING.
Section 18 of the Outer Continental Shelf Lands Act (43 U.S.C.
1344) is amended--
(1) in subsection (a)--
(A) by striking ``subsections (c) and (d) of this
section, shall prepare and periodically revise,'' and
inserting ``this section, shall issue every five
years'';
(B) by adding at the end the following:
``(5) Each five-year program shall include at least two
lease sales per year.''; and
(C) in paragraph (3), by inserting ``domestic
energy security,'' after ``between'';
(2) by redesignating subsections (f) through (h) as
subsections (h) through (j), respectively; and
(3) by inserting after subsection (e) the following:
``(f) Five-Year Program for 2022 Through 2027.--The Secretary shall
issue the five-year oil and gas leasing program for 2022 through 2027
by not later than June 30, 2022.
``(g) Subsequent Leasing Programs.--
``(1) In general.--Not later than 36 months after
conducting the first lease sale under an oil and gas leasing
program prepared pursuant to this section, the Secretary shall
begin preparing the subsequent oil and gas leasing program
under this section.
``(2) Requirement.--Each subsequent oil and gas leasing
program under this section shall be approved by not later than
180 days before the expiration of the previous oil and gas
leasing program.''.
